Top-Themen

AppleEntwicklungHardwareInternetLinuxMicrosoftMultimediaNetzwerkeOff TopicSicherheitSonstige SystemeVirtualisierungWeiterbildungZusammenarbeit

Aktuelle Themen

Administrator.de FeedbackApache ServerAppleAssemblerAudioAusbildungAuslandBackupBasicBatch & ShellBenchmarksBibliotheken & ToolkitsBlogsCloud-DiensteClusterCMSCPU, RAM, MainboardsCSSC und C++DatenbankenDatenschutzDebianDigitiales FernsehenDNSDrucker und ScannerDSL, VDSLE-BooksE-BusinessE-MailEntwicklungErkennung und -AbwehrExchange ServerFestplatten, SSD, RaidFirewallFlatratesGoogle AndroidGrafikGrafikkarten & MonitoreGroupwareHardwareHosting & HousingHTMLHumor (lol)Hyper-VIconsIDE & EditorenInformationsdiensteInstallationInstant MessagingInternetInternet DomäneniOSISDN & AnaloganschlüsseiTunesJavaJavaScriptKiXtartKVMLAN, WAN, WirelessLinuxLinux DesktopLinux NetzwerkLinux ToolsLinux UserverwaltungLizenzierungMac OS XMicrosoftMicrosoft OfficeMikroTik RouterOSMonitoringMultimediaMultimedia & ZubehörNetzwerkeNetzwerkgrundlagenNetzwerkmanagementNetzwerkprotokolleNotebook & ZubehörNovell NetwareOff TopicOpenOffice, LibreOfficeOutlook & MailPapierkorbPascal und DelphiPeripheriegerätePerlPHPPythonRechtliche FragenRedHat, CentOS, FedoraRouter & RoutingSambaSAN, NAS, DASSchriftartenSchulung & TrainingSEOServerServer-HardwareSicherheitSicherheits-ToolsSicherheitsgrundlagenSolarisSonstige SystemeSoziale NetzwerkeSpeicherkartenStudentenjobs & PraktikumSuche ProjektpartnerSuseSwitche und HubsTipps & TricksTK-Netze & GeräteUbuntuUMTS, EDGE & GPRSUtilitiesVB for ApplicationsVerschlüsselung & ZertifikateVideo & StreamingViren und TrojanerVirtualisierungVisual StudioVmwareVoice over IPWebbrowserWebentwicklungWeiterbildungWindows 7Windows 8Windows 10Windows InstallationWindows MobileWindows NetzwerkWindows ServerWindows SystemdateienWindows ToolsWindows UpdateWindows UserverwaltungWindows VistaWindows XPXenserverXMLZusammenarbeit
GELÖST

bat in exe als Ressource mit Cpp ausführen

Frage Entwicklung C und C++

Mitglied: JohntherippA

JohntherippA (Level 1) - Jetzt verbinden

26.03.2007, aktualisiert 29.03.2007, 5884 Aufrufe, 8 Kommentare

Hi

ich möchte eine C++ Datei schreiben, in die ich am Ende eine BAT datei in die fertige Exe mit dem Reseditor implementieren. Diese soll dann aufgerufen werden von dem Programm. Geht das ?
Mitglied: miniversum
26.03.2007 um 21:03 Uhr
Na müßte doch auch über den SYSTEM Befehl gehen das die bat ausgeführt wird.

miniversum
Bitte warten ..
Mitglied: JohntherippA
26.03.2007 um 21:25 Uhr
Ja das geht ja auch. Möchte allerdings keine Datei extra haben.
Geht auch das er das dann extraiert
Bitte warten ..
Mitglied: miniversum
26.03.2007 um 21:31 Uhr
Du meinst das die exe die bat datei erstellt oder das die befehle der bate datei durch die exe ersetzt werden?

miniversum
Bitte warten ..
Mitglied: JohntherippA
26.03.2007 um 22:43 Uhr
Ich meine so eine Art Setupdatei. Wenn ich eine Setupdatei habe, sind da ja die meisten Anwendungen drinnen. So was will ich mit C++ machen.
Bitte warten ..
Mitglied: miniversum
27.03.2007 um 11:13 Uhr
Du meinst einen Installer der Dateien Kopiert und so?
Bitte warten ..
Mitglied: JohntherippA
27.03.2007 um 22:24 Uhr
ja genau. Die sind ja irgendwie in der Exe vorhanden. soll so in etwa aussehen:
(Verzeichnisbaum)
C++.exe
|--Datei1.bat
|--Datei2.bat
|--Datei3.dat

So in etwa. Der soll dann Datei1, Datei2 und Datei3 irgendwo hin installieren. Will keine Setupdatei machen. Nur das ich nur eine Datei saven muss für das Prog. Im C++ sollen noch ein paar Befehlszeilen sein, die ausgeführt werden sollen. Zum Beispiel cout<<"Erfolgreich", oder ifstream...
Bitte warten ..
Mitglied: miniversum
28.03.2007 um 09:52 Uhr
a) könntest du das doch direkt in Batch machen, oder warum in C++?
b) Schau dir mal ein Selbtsentpackendes Archiv von Winrar an oder iexpress (start, ausführen, "iextress"). Über Beide kansnt du fertige selbstentpackende Exe Dateien Erzeugen die dir Dateien Kopieren, Meldungen ausgeben und so Zeugs.
c) wenns umbedingt C++ sein soll dan ists das einfachste die Befehle von batch (wenns nur copy ist) einfach über SYSTEM("copy .... "); einzubinden. Dabei kannst Du ja auch die Dateinamen udn Verzeichnisse udn so als Variabeln innerhalb von C++ übergeben.

miniversum
Bitte warten ..
Mitglied: JohntherippA
29.03.2007 um 21:19 Uhr
vielen Dank. Ich habe mir jetzt einfach mal die Mühe gemacht, dass er die Dateien erst schreibt

Mit freundlichen Grüßen
RippA
Bitte warten ..
Neuester Wissensbeitrag
Microsoft

Lizenzwiederverkauf und seine Tücken

(5)

Erfahrungsbericht von DerWoWusste zum Thema Microsoft ...

Ähnliche Inhalte
Windows Server
gelöst Sichtbares Ausführen einer BAT-Datei mittels GPOs (10)

Frage von DasWombat1993 zum Thema Windows Server ...

Windows Tools
Suche Batch Scheduler (.bat .cmd .exe) (8)

Frage von hf1965 zum Thema Windows Tools ...

Windows 10
gelöst RDP Datei bzw. mstsc .exe unter Windows 10 immer mit erhöhten Rechten ausführen (4)

Frage von zeroblue2005 zum Thema Windows 10 ...

Heiß diskutierte Inhalte
Windows Netzwerk
Windows 10 RDP geht nicht (16)

Frage von Fiasko zum Thema Windows Netzwerk ...

Windows Server
Outlook Verbindungsversuch mit Exchange (15)

Frage von xbast1x zum Thema Windows Server ...

Microsoft Office
Keine Updates für Office 2016 (13)

Frage von Motte990 zum Thema Microsoft Office ...